Right.. > > I have #define'd DEBUG in cmd_ide.c and compared the debug > messages for > my ED Mini V2 (working) and my OpenRD-Client (not working). I > have also > performed manual SATA and IDE reset sequences. Short story: > > 1) the board code correctly initializes the SATA link, which > correctly > detects a disk if there is one: > > Marvell>> md.l f1082300 4 > f1082300: 00000113 14010000 00000300 010300b0 ................ > Marvell>> md.l f1084300 4 > f1084300: 00000000 00000000 00000300 010300b0 ................ > Marvell>> > > (this is consistent with my system which has a 1.5 GBps disk > on port 0). > > 2) The problem is that the drive appears continuously non-RDY > (SStatus > register remains at 0x80 while on the ED Mini V2 it ends up at 0x50, > which basically means it is ready). > > I will now compare the MPP / GPIO settings performed by the > FLASH-resident U-Boot (its 'ide reset' command works ok) to those in > effect when the patched u-boot fails. Maybe one GPIO controls > power to > the internal SATA port, although I doubt it -- if the drive > was off, the > controller would not see it at all, and SStatus at F1082300 would not > report it present. I tried tweaking MPP setup for SATA related stuff, it's multiplexed with UART and other I/Os (NAND), What I observed: if I boot kernel with sata support, kernel sata driver works properly and I can detect and use IDE devices. So I doubt MPP, I don't know kernel (latest stable) overrides MPP settings done by u-boot??
